Output e34c172a9c1d3cf8d52137dff12c865f16b20170e3ecb1f01a7a84888199cdb6:3

value
2894535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a947b71e07bf9c15abc3d5cfda57d6b5fa89eb7 OP_EQUAL
address
3BQZRbtXhi21ffz8iCCCuuqAk5BStHg6kS
transaction
e34c172a9c1d3cf8d52137dff12c865f16b20170e3ecb1f01a7a84888199cdb6
spent
true